Nivi takes on Mount Everest

"There is no force that is equal to a women determined to rise." -W.E.B DuBois. Majestic Mount Everest, also known in Nepal as Sagarmāthā and in China as Chomolungma, is Earth's highest mountain. Its peak is 8,848 metres above sea level. So when one of my closest friends, Nivedeta (Nivi) Chatroogoon informed me about this amazing adventure that … Continue reading Nivi takes on Mount Everest